Section 2500.12 - Waiver of benefit void

An agreement by the tenant to waive the benefit of any provision of the act or this Subchapter is void; provided, however, that based upon a negotiated settlement between the parties and with the approval of the division, or a court of competent jurisdiction, or where a tenant is represented by counsel, a tenant may withdraw, with prejudice, any complaint pending before the division. Such settlement shall be binding upon subsequent tenants. However, where the settlement encompasses surrender of occupancy by the tenant or the tenant is no longer in possession of the housing accommodation as of the date of the settlement, such settlement shall not be binding upon any subsequent tenant, except to the extent that the complaint being settled is subject to the time limitations set forth in the act and this Subchapter.
